Dai Nippon Printing Co., Ltd. is a prominent player in the printing industry, offering a wide range of services and products across various sectors, including smart communication, life & healthcare, and electronics.

In its latest earnings report for the first six months ending September 30, 2025, Dai Nippon Printing Co. reported a 4.3% increase in net sales compared to the same period last year, reaching ¥738,701 million. However, the company experienced a significant decline in net income attributable to parent company shareholders, which fell by 32.7% to ¥60,358 million.

The company’s operating income saw a notable rise of 22.2% to ¥46,648 million, and ordinary income increased by 5.8% to ¥52,910 million. Despite the positive movement in sales and operating income, comprehensive income dropped by 52.9% to ¥29,420 million, indicating challenges in maintaining profitability. Segment-wise, the Life & Healthcare division showed a strong performance with a significant increase in segment income.

Looking ahead, Dai Nippon Printing Co. forecasts a modest growth in net sales for the full fiscal year ending March 31, 2026, with expectations set at ¥1,500,000 million, a 2.9% increase from the previous year. The company remains cautiously optimistic about its future performance, focusing on strategic initiatives to enhance its market position and drive sustainable growth.
